The main difference between the words, besides a letter and their pronunciations, is their parts of speech. Advise (with an s pronounced \z\) is a verb that indicates the act of giving an opinion, suggestion, recommendation, or information, while advice (with a c pronounced \s\) is a noun that refers to the opinion, … See more As a verb, advise has inflected forms: the present tense advises, the past tense advised, and the present participle advising. In other words, someone has … david king weather 2022Web2 days ago · 1 `advice'. Advice /ɑdˈvaɪs/ is a noun. If you give someone advice, you tell them what you think they should do. Take my advice – don't bother. She promised to follow his advice. Advice is an uncountable noun. Don't talk about ` advices ' or ` an advice '. However, you can talk about a piece of advice.
